description abstractThis procedure covers the quantitative determination of the asphalt binder content of asphalt mixtures by testing a sample with a nuclear gauge that utilizes neutron-thermalization techniques.
The values expressed in SI units are to be regarded as the standard. The inch-pound equivalents of the SI units may be approximate.
Nuclear gauge operations and maintenance are not covered in detail. See the manufacturer's manual for details.
This test method involves potentially hazardous materials, operations, and equipment. This method does not purport to address all of the safety concerns associated with its use. All operators will be trained in radiation safety prior to operating nuclear gauges. Some agencies require the use of personal monitoring devices such as a thermoluminescent dosimeter or film badge.
